Protein-Packed Snack Ideas

As you're fueling up with fresh fruit and veggies, don't forget to boost your snack game with protein-packed options that'll keep you full and satisfied throughout the day. Protein is essential for muscle repair and growth, and it can also help curb hunger and support weight management.

Here are some protein-packed snack ideas to add to your meal prep routine:

  • High-Protein Smoothies: Blend Greek yogurt, frozen berries, spinach, and almond milk for a quick and invigorating snack that packs around 20 grams of protein.

  • Creative Trail Mix Combos: Mix nuts, seeds, and dried fruit for a healthy snack that's high in protein and fiber. Try adding protein-rich ingredients like peanut butter or chocolate chips for an extra boost.

  • Savory Protein Bites: Whip up a batch of no-bake energy balls using rolled oats, almond butter, and protein powder. These bite-sized snacks are perfect for on-the-go.

  • Homemade Jerky Flavors: Marinate lean meats like turkey or chicken in your favorite seasonings and then bake until crispy. This protein-rich snack is perfect for stashing in your desk or bag for a quick pick-me-up.

Healthy Dip and Spread Essentials

You'll elevate your snack game with a variety of healthy dips and spreads that not only tantalize your taste buds but also provide a nutrient-dense punch. From classic hummus to creative avocado pairings, these essentials will transform your snack routine.

Here are some healthy dip and spread options to get you started:

Dip/Spread Key Ingredients Health Benefits
Classic Hummus Chickpeas, tahini, lemon juice High in protein, fiber, and healthy fats
Roasted Red Pepper Hummus Roasted red peppers, chickpeas, garlic Antioxidant-rich, anti-inflammatory
Avocado Spread Avocado, lime juice, salt Rich in healthy fats, fiber, and vitamins
Spinach and Artichoke Dip Spinach, artichoke hearts, Greek yogurt High in protein, fiber, and antioxidants

When preparing your healthy dips and spreads, be sure to choose whole, nutrient-dense ingredients and limit added sugars and preservatives. Infused Water and Herbal Teas

Staying hydrated has never been easier or more flavorful with infused water and herbal teas, which offer an invigorating and healthy alternative to sugary drinks. As you explore the world of hydration options, you'll discover the numerous benefits of infused water and herbal teas.

Not only do they quench your thirst, but they also provide essential v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ants that boost your energy and support overall well-being.

Here are some tips to get you started:

  • Experiment with flavorful tea blends like peppermint, chamomile, and hibiscus to find your favorite.
  • Try tea brewing techniques like cold-brewing or steeping to release the best amount of flavor and nutrients.
  • Add slices of citrus fruits, cucumbers, or berries to your infused water for a revitalizing twist.
  • Make a large batch of infused water or herbal tea on the weekend and store it in the fridge for up to 3 days, perfect for grab-and-go hydration.
